MANILA, Philippines — Senator-elect Christopher “Bong” Go expressed his gratitude to the Filipino community during an event held in Tokyo, Japan as part of the visit of President Duterte.

“Thank you for giving me the opportunity to serve you. Not all Filipinos are given the privilege to help improve the lives of their countrymen. I will not waste this trust that you have given me,” Go said in his speech.

He also offered his victory to overseas Filipino workers  (OFWs). “This feat would not have been possible if not for the love and support of every Filipino, including our beloved overseas Filipino workers whose steadfast support gave me a big boost to achieve one of the sweetest victories in my life.”

He assured the Filipino community that he will not only continue to become their bridge to the President, but also become their voice in the Senate. 

Go also vowed to support the Filipino oversees community by assuring them that their grievances will be addressed as part of his work as a senator.

“You may rest assured my office will always be open to hear your complaints, grievances and suggestions on how to improve government service,” Go said.

The establishment of the Department for OFW concerns will be a top priority of Go in the Senate. The proposed department will serve as a one-stop-shop in providing legal assistance for OFWs in distress; to arrange a full migration cycle approach in promoting migrant’s rights from pre-employment as well as on-site and reintegration services; and to launch a shared database system that contains important information of all OFWs to aid in tracking their status and fast track delivery of assistance, especially to distressed workers.
